Immediate response is critical, ideally within 24-48 hours, to prevent mold growth and structural damage. In Millsap, our hot, humid Texas climate accelerates microbial growth, making rapid drying essential year-round. Additionally, be aware that sudden summer thunderstorms and potential freeze events in winter are common local causes of water intrusion that require prompt professional attention.
Choose a provider licensed by the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) for mold remediation and/or fire damage restoration, which is a state requirement. Look for a company with 24/7 emergency response based in or near Parker County to ensure fast arrival times, and verify they are fully insured and have strong references from local homeowners, as rural properties like ours often have unique construction materials.
While labor and material costs can be slightly lower than in metro areas like Dallas-Fort Worth, mobilization fees for specialized equipment to our more rural location can influence the total. The primary cost factors are the square footage affected, the type of damage (e.g., category of water, soot type), and the materials in your home, such as local stone foundations or wood siding common in older Millsap houses.
Millsap's high humidity, especially from spring through fall, creates a perfect environment for mold to thrive inside walls and attics after any moisture event. Effective remediation must include not only removing the mold but also correcting the source of moisture and ensuring proper dehumidification to meet Texas-specific containment and disposal standards, preventing rapid recurrence.
